Pianos Moved the Way They Should Be
A grand piano never travels on its wheels across a room and into a truck. We remove the legs and lyre, mount the body on a proper piano board, pad and wrap it fully, and move it on a skid with straps rated for the weight. Uprights get boarded and wrapped the same careful way. The carry path is planned first, with floor protection laid across terrazzo and tile, because a scratched floor or a dinged jamb is not part of the deal.

High-Rise Specialty Moves
Moving a grand out of an oceanfront tower adds a layer most movers stumble on. We coordinate the freight-elevator reservation, file the certificate of insurance the HOA demands and work inside the building’s move window, so the piano clears the dock and the elevator without a fight.
